At Trinity Bellwoods’ welcoming, scruffy diner, a vintage Coke fridge doubles as an oyster cooler, the tables are salmon-hued Formica, and every night, couples and friends spend hours draining bottles of wine, slouched in the weathered faux-leather-and-wood booths. The neighbourly atmosphere is matched by good, if not exemplary, bistro fare. Two fat, creamy crab cakes are twanged with scallions and a kicky mango-chipotle tartar sauce. Smoked trout is terrific draped over a stack of sweet, crumbly corn cakes. The kitchen falters with proteins: a grilled pork chop is unyieldingly tough, and the bland cornbread alongside disintegrates in an ulcer-inducingly acidic bacon-sage vinaigrette. For dessert, a moist chipotle-spiked brownie brings subtle heat as it hits the back of your throat.
